| Background: Ascorbic acid and its salts are low-toxicity products, which are routinely used in food industries as
antioxidants. The aim of the present study was to evaluate the effect of 10% sodium ascorbate on the bond strength
of two all-in-one adhesive systems to NaOCl-treated dentin.
Material and Methods: After exposing the dentin on the facial surface of 90 sound human premolars and mounting
in an acrylic resin mold, the exposed dentin surfaces were polished with 600-grit SiC paper under running water.
Then the samples were randomly divided into 6 groups of 15. Groups 1 and 4 were the controls, in which no surface
preparation was carried out. In groups 2 and 5 the dentin surfaces were treated with 5.25% NaOCl alone for 10
minutes and in groups 3 and 6 with 5.25% NaOCl for 10 minutes followed by 10% sodium ascorbate for 10 minutes.
Then composite resin cylinders, measuring 2 mm in diameter and 2 mm in height, were bonded on the dentin
surfaces in groups 1, 2 and 3 with Clearfil S3
Bond and in groups 4, 5 and 6 with Adper Easy One adhesive systems
according to manufacturers’ instructions. The samples were stored in distilled water for 24 hours at 37°C and then
thermocycled. Finally, the samples underwent shear bond strength test in a universal testing machine at a strain rate
of 1 mm/min. Data were analyzed with two-way ANOVA and post hoc Tukey tests at α=0.05.
Results: The differences between groups 1 and 2 (P=0.01), 1 and 5 (P=0.003). 1 and 6 (P=0.03) and 4 and 5
(P=0.03) were statistically significant. Two-by-two comparisons did not reveal any significant difference between
other groups (P>0.05).
Conclusions: Use of 10% sodium ascorbate for 10 minutes restored the decreased bond strength of the adhesive
systems to that of the control groups. |
